Output 8e4aeae81e260551c8deb53a84efb6513fc84f2edf67f359b88f5a5fa23abe85:38

value
103709
script pubkey
OP_0 OP_PUSHBYTES_20 b0c42f2b34f7626368849f51a9789470f0941656
address
bc1qkrzz72e57a3xx6yynag6j7y5wrcfg9jkddsl6m
transaction
8e4aeae81e260551c8deb53a84efb6513fc84f2edf67f359b88f5a5fa23abe85
confirmations
173155
spent
true